The Experts
Tony Buckingham   Managing Director, Buckingham Covers
Tony

With over 30 years experience, Tony is recognised worldwide as a leading authority on first day and commemorative covers. He was the first winner of the prestigious Rowland Hill Award for his contribution to philately. Together with Cath, Tony founded and ran Benham (the UK’s largest cover publisher) until he sold the company in 1997. He edited Collect FDC for nearly 20 years and has served on the Philatelic Trade Society Council. He is a regular contributor to Stamp Magazine, Gibbons Stamp Monthly and other leading collectables publications. He has also written two murder stories (all he needs is a good editor!). Cath Buckingham   Design Director
Cath

Cath Buckingham is one of the world’s leading cover designers and winner of 8 Royal Mail awards for cover design and 3 Fasson Awards for design and printing. Cath designs all Buckingham Covers, including the envelope, the postmarks (jargon buster pop-up) and all our Cinderella stamps (jargon buster pop-up). Cath does all her own picture research, working with top artists to source the best illustrations for each cover.
